10 Best Vue.js Tree View Components

Find the best Vue.js tree view component for your project with this list of 10 popular and well-maintained options. Tree views are a great way to visualize hierarchical data.

Vue Treeselect

A multi-select component with nested options support for Vue.js

"Vue Treeselect"

Features

  • Single & multiple select with nested options support
  • Fuzzy matching
  • Async searching
  • Delayed loading (load data of deep level options only when needed)
  • Keyboard support (navigate using Arrow Up & Arrow Down keys, select option using Enter key, etc.)
  • Rich options & highly customizable
  • Supports a wide range of browsers (see below)
  • RTL support

View on GitHub

Vue Treeselect

A Tree Select Plugin For Vue2.0+ http://zdy1988.github.io/vue-treeselect
This Plugin is based on vue-jstree, Some “props” can be used for reference !

"Vue Treeselect"

View on GitHub

Vue Jstree

A Tree Plugin For Vue2.0+ http://zdy1988.github.io/vue-jstree

"Vue Jstree"

View on GitHub

Vue.D3.tree

Vue component to display tree based on D3.js layout https://david-desmaisons.github.io/Vue.D3.tree/tree

"Vue.D3.tree"

View on GitHub

Vue Tree

tree and multi-select component based on Vue.js 2.0 https://github.com/halower/vue2-tree/blob/master/README.md

"Vue Tree"

View on GitHub

Vue Drag Tree

a Vue’s drag and drop tree component || 🌾Demo https://vigilant-curran-d6fec6.netlify.com/#/
It’s a tree components(Vue2.x) that allow you to drag and drop the node to exchange their data .

"Vue Drag Tree"

Feature

  • Double click on an node to turn it into a folder
  • Drag and Drop the tree node, even between two different levels
  • Customize your node (how to display node. eg: node name and left icon )
  • Controls whether a particular node can be dragged and whether the node can be plugged into other nodes
  • Append/Remove Node in any level (#TODO)

View on GitHub

Vue Org Tree

A simple organization tree based on Vue2.x https://hukaibaihu.github.io/vue-org-tree/

"Vue Org Tree"

View on GitHub

Vue Draggable Nested Tree

Please use the he-tree-vue, vue-draggable-nested-tree will no longer be maintained. https://he-tree-vue.phphe.com/

"Vue Draggable Nested Tree"

View on GitHub

Vue Json Tree View

A JSON Tree View Component for Vue.js https://devblog.digimondo.io/building-a-json-tree-view-component-in-vue-js-from-scratch-in-six-steps-ce0c05c2fdd8#.dkwh4jo2m

"Vue Json Tree View"

View on GitHub

Liquor Tree

Tree component based on Vue.js A Vue tree component that allows you to present hierarchically organized data in a nice and logical manner.

"Liquor Tree"

Features

  • drag&drop
  • mobile friendly
  • events for every action
  • flexible configuration
  • any number of instances per page
  • multi selection
  • keyboard navigation
  • filtering
  • sorting
  • integration with Vuex

View on GitHub

#vuejs #vue #vue-js #javascript

10 Best Vue.js Tree View Components
160.05 GEEK